Kevin Ryde <user42@zip.com.au> writes:

> I guess this is just a missing index for the string-ref call in the
> getc handler of make-line-buffering-input-port.  Judging by the
> substring taken I guess it should be 0.

Right.  Fixed in both branches, although I think the code hasn't
been used for three years or so...

The (ice-9 lineio) module was there to fix a deficiency in the core
ports and the original author expected it to be removed somewhen.
Maybe we should just do that.  Anybody?
